Storage and Organization in a Motorhome: Practical Tips for a Tidy Home on Wheels

Effective organization and storage in a motorhome are essential for making the most of the limited space and creating a comfortable living environment. With clever solutions and practical storage systems, you can neatly stow your travel essentials and create a comfortable living space that meets your needs.

Making the Most of Storage Space in a Motorhome

1. Maximize storage space:

Overhead cabinets: Use the space above the seating areas or along the ceiling for additional storage.

Under-bed drawers: Use the space under the bed to store clothes, shoes, and other items.

Modular shelving systems: Customize shelves and cabinets to your individual needs to optimize the available storage space.

2. Smart storage solutions:

Hanging storage bags: Attach your bags to doors or walls to keep small items like keys, sunglasses, or charging cables within easy reach.

Foldable baskets and boxes: Use stackable or collapsible containers to organize food supplies, cooking utensils, and other items.

Hangers and hooks: Hang jackets, towels, or bags on hooks or hangers to save space and keep things tidy.

3. Stay organized:

Regular decluttering: Reduce your belongings to the essentials and avoid unnecessary items to create space and reduce the weight of the RV.

Daily routine: Take time every day to tidy up and clean the RV to prevent clutter and chaos.

Labeling and marking: Label drawers, baskets, and boxes to keep track of your belongings and make it easier to find items.

4. Safety and Stability:

Securing systems: Use straps or mounts to secure items while driving and prevent them from sliding or tipping over.

Weight distribution: Make sure to store heavy items as close to the floor and near the axle as possible to ensure the stability and safety of the RV.

Tips for storage in a motorhome:

Multi-purpose use: Choose furniture and storage solutions that serve multiple functions to save space and increase the versatility of your RV.

Flexible design: Opt for flexible and customizable storage systems that can adapt to your changing needs while on the road.

Minimalist design: Reduce unnecessary decorations and furniture to visually enlarge the space and create an open and airy atmosphere.

With these practical tips and clever solutions, you can maintain order and organization in your RV and create a comfortable and functional living space, no matter where your travels take you.
